Heirloom/heritage seeds are also an important part of our business. Not only are heirloom varieties interesting and fun to grow, they represent a cultural history from across the world, particularly that of early settlers who developed some of the toughest, most productive cultivars around. Our goal is to continue this development in Saskatchewan by selecting the heartiest open-pollinated plants for their seeds.
